Synopsis: Based on Dan Brown's international bestselling thriller "The Lost Symbol," the series follows the early adventures of young Harvard symbologist Robert Langdon (Ashley Zukerman), who must solve a series of deadly puzzles to save his kidnapped mentor and thwart a chilling global conspiracy.
· Peacock Original drama DAN BROWN'S THE LOST SYMBOL will premiere on Thursday, September 16 with one episode. A new episode will premiere each week.
· Based on Dan Brown's international bestselling thriller "The Lost Symbol," the series follows the early adventures of young Harvard symbologist Robert Langdon, who must solve a series of deadly puzzles to save his kidnapped mentor and thwart a chilling global conspiracy.
· The cast includes Ashley Zukerman ("Succession"), Valorie Curry ("Blair Witch"), Sumalee Montano ("10 Cloverfield Lane"), Rick Gonzalez ("Arrow"), Eddie Izzard ("Ocean's Thirteen") and Beau Knapp ("Seven Seconds").
· The series is produced by CBS Studios, Imagine Television Studios and Universal Television, a division of Universal Studio Group. Dan Dworkin and Jay Beattie will serve as writers and executive producers for the series. Dan Brown, Brian Grazer, Ron Howard, Samie Kim Falvey, Anna Culp, John Weber and Frank Siracusa also serve as executive producers. Dan Trachtenberg executive produced and directed the pilot.
